1.XML是区分大小写字母的,HTML不区分。

2.在HTML中,如果上下文清楚地显示出段落或者列表键在何处结尾,那么你可以省略或者之类的结束标记。在XML中,绝对不能省略掉结束标记。
3.在XML中,拥有单个标记而没有匹配的结束标记的元素必须用一个/字符作为结尾。这样分析器就知道不用查找结束标记了。
4.在XML中,属性值必须分装在引号中。在HTML中,引号是可用可不用的。
5.在HTML中,可以拥有不带值的属性名。在XML中,所有的属性都必须带有相应的值。
2. xml 即可扩展标记语言,是Internet环境中跨平台的、依赖于内容的技术,是当前处理结构化文档信息的有力工具,满足了Web内容发布与交换的需要,适合作为各种存储与共享的通用平台。
1.HTML是超文本标记语言,是为了在各种网络环境之间,不同文件格式之间进行交流而使用的语言格式。XML是可扩展标记语言,是用于结构化文档的标记语言,可从视为定义标记的广义化的HTML。
所以功能上还是有些区别的。
PDF格式发票是指电子发票以PDF(Portable Document Format,可移植文档格式)的形式进行存储和传输的发票。
OFD即“开放式文档格式”,具有完整的版式、图像、文字、音频、视频等多媒体元素,并且支持数字签名和安全加密等功能。
XML文件是数据文件,格式与HTML文档非常相似,XML文件可以被认为是基于文本的数据库,XML根据所描述的数据描述内容,XML文件可以完全由程序处理为数据,也可以与其他计算机上的类似数据一起存储。
扩展标记语言XML是一种简单的数据存储语言,使用一系列简单的标记描述数据,而这些标记可以用方便的方式建立,虽然XML占用的空间比二进制数据要占用更多的空间,但XML极其简单易于掌握和使用。